Which term describes techniques used to prevent dynamic analysis by fingerprinting the emulated system environment?

Prepare for the Certified Ethical Hacker Version 11 Exam with a comprehensive test featuring flashcards and multiple choice questions, each accompanied by hints and explanations to ensure a thorough understanding. Ace your ethical hacking exam with confidence!

Multiple Choice

Which term describes techniques used to prevent dynamic analysis by fingerprinting the emulated system environment?

Explanation:
Techniques used to prevent dynamic analysis by fingerprinting the emulated system environment are called anti-emulation. Malware analysts often run samples in sandboxes or virtual machines to observe behavior, but some malware checks for signs it’s in such an environment. It might look for virtualization-related artifacts, odd timing, or other emulator indicators, and if detected, it changes its behavior or stays dormant to avoid revealing its payload. This deliberate evasion is what anti-emulation covers. The other options don’t fit this idea. Anti-goat isn’t a standard term in malware analysis; add-on viruses describe extra code appended to software, not techniques to evade analysis; and persistent viruses refer to how malware survives reboots, not to avoiding dynamic analysis through emulator detection.

Techniques used to prevent dynamic analysis by fingerprinting the emulated system environment are called anti-emulation. Malware analysts often run samples in sandboxes or virtual machines to observe behavior, but some malware checks for signs it’s in such an environment. It might look for virtualization-related artifacts, odd timing, or other emulator indicators, and if detected, it changes its behavior or stays dormant to avoid revealing its payload. This deliberate evasion is what anti-emulation covers.

The other options don’t fit this idea. Anti-goat isn’t a standard term in malware analysis; add-on viruses describe extra code appended to software, not techniques to evade analysis; and persistent viruses refer to how malware survives reboots, not to avoiding dynamic analysis through emulator detection.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y